Reporter comment USDA

As filed

Compared to last week slaughter steers were 1.00 to 4.00 higher and slaughter heifers 3.00 higher with a good offering of high quality steers and heifer and active buyer participation. Holstein slaughter steers had instances of higher/lower today. Cows were 1.00 to 5.00 lower with bulls 3.00 to 5.00 higher. Feeder steers were trending higher with feeder heifers and bulls too few to compare this week.
